Linxon in Glasgow is seeking an Assistant Quantity Surveyor to support the commercial and contractual delivery of complex civil, electrical and commissioning works across Substation sites. You will be hands-on with measurement, valuation, change control and cost reporting in a live EPC environment.
The role offers exposure to multi-site infrastructure projects, with mentoring from senior QS and opportunities to develop core QS skills within a major utility programme.
Job Title: Assistant Quantity Surveyor
Location: Glasgow
As a Assistant Quantity Surveyor, you’ll support the commercial and contractual delivery of complex civil, electrical and commissioning works across Substation sites. This is a hands-on role where you develop core QS skills - measurement, valuation, change control and cost reporting on a live EPC environment.
Essential: Degree (or final-year/just-graduated) in Quantity Surveying, Commercial Management or related discipline. Strong numeracy and Excel skills; clear written communication and attention to detail. Interest in infrastructure delivery.
Desirable: Any placement/industry experience in civil engineering, building, power or utilities. Familiarity with processes (EWNs/CENs) and basic programme understanding. Experience preparing scopes/RFPs or reviewing subcontractor applications.

We combine Hitachi Energy’s deep technological knowledge and Atkins Realis’s project management expertise to create a company dedicated to substations - we are Linxon. Linxon’s vision is to deliver the best market offering for turnkey substation projects through world-class power technologies and delivering the highest level of competence in managing infrastructure projects.
As a leading engineering company, we help our customers with turnkey substation solutions in the field of power transmission, renewable energy and transportation.
